Probable XI and how to watch Milan’s friendly against Lumezzane

By Isak Möller -

AC Milan will play their first friendly game of the pre-season this afternoon, taking on Serie C side Lumezzane at Milanello. It will be behind closed doors but fans will still be able to stream it. 

Milan will fly to Los Angeles tomorrow but first, they will take on Serie C side Lumezzane in a friendly game. The two sides faced each other last summer as well and the Rossoneri won the game 3-2.

Stefano Pioli is expected to field the following starting XI for today’s clash, having switched to a 4-3-3: Sportiello; Calabria, Gabbia, Tomori, Florenzi; Loftus-Cheek, Krunic, Pobega; Romero, Colombo, Pulisic.

The game will be streamed by Sky Sport and DAZN in Italy, while fans from abroad most likely will be able to watch on Milan’s Youtube. There might be a membership requirement on Youtube, but it should be streamed for free on the Rossoneri’s app.

Tijjani Reijnders is not expected to feature in the game and he will have his presentation at 14:30 CEST today.
